Heat-conducting insulated pressure sensitive tape and preparation method thereof

The invention relates to a heat-conducting insulated pressure sensitive tape and a preparation method of the tape. The principal technical features are as follows: the heat-conducting insulated pressure sensitive tape comprises a heat-conducting insulated pressure sensitive tape without a base material and a heat-conducting insulated pressure sensitive tape with the base material; and the preparation method comprises the following steps: (1) preparing a polyacrylate adhesive; (2) preparing modified heat-conducting filler dispersion liquid; and (3) mixing the polyacrylate adhesive prepared in the step (1) with the modified heat-conducting filler dispersion liquid prepared in the step (2), coating wet glues with different thicknesses onto a release protection layer by a film coater, and drying in a gradually heating way to prepare the heat-conducting insulated pressure sensitive tape without the base material; or bonding with the both faces of the base material to prepare the heat-conducting insulated pressure sensitive tape with the base material. The heat-conducting insulated pressure sensitive tape is high in heat conductivity, good in bonding performance and excellent in ageing resistance, has excellent die cutting processability, and can be widely applied to bonding of heat radiating fins and heating devices such as a CPU (central processing unit), a power tube, a module power supply and the like, as well as bonding of screens, frames and injection molded boards in electronic products such as a mobile phone, an LED (light emitting diode) device and the like.

Reactive pressure-sensitive adhesive having performance of structural adhesive after being cured, and preparation method thereof

The invention relates to a reactive pressure-sensitive adhesive having the performance of a structural adhesive after being cured, and a preparation method thereof. The pressure-sensitive adhesive is prepared from the following materials in parts by weight: a) 100 parts of soluble acrylate copolymer; b) 80 to 120 parts of epoxy resin; and c) 8 to 12 parts of epoxy resin latency curing agent, wherein the soluble acrylate copolymer is formed by polymerizing the following raw materials in a free radical polymerization reaction manner: 50% to 65% of alkyl ester with the acrylic carbon atom number from 1 to 8, 5% to 15% of styrene, 10% to 15% of alkyl ester with the methylacrylic acid carbon atom number from 1 to 8 and 35% to 5% of alkyl acrylate. At the normal temperature, under the action of the plasticization of the epoxy resin to the acrylate polymer, the pressure sensitivity of the acrylate polymer is generated, so that the pressure-sensitive adhesive can be used as an ordinary pressure-sensitive adhesive. After the pressure-sensitive adhesive is heated, the curing agent reacts with the epoxy resin; and the cured epoxy resin is toughened by the acrylic ester, so that the pressure-sensitive adhesive has the adhesion strength of the structural adhesive.

Vacuum bag sealing adhesive tape applicable under room temperature to 220 DEG C, and preparation method thereof

The invention relates to a pressure sensitive vacuum bag sealing adhesive tape applicable under room temperature to 220 DEG C. Chlorinated butyl rubber is adopted as the base adhesive material of the sealing adhesive tape. Tackifying resin, a filler, a vulcanizing agent, an activator, a scorch retarder, a water-absorbing agent, and a coupling agent are added to the base adhesive material. The adhesive tape has the following advantage: the air permeation of chlorinated butyl rubber is the lowest among all general rubbers, such that chlorinated butyl rubber has good air tightness; the sealing adhesive tape has good heat resistance, wherein phenolic resin vulcanized chlorinated butyl rubber has as an application temperature range from room temperature to 220 DEG C; the sealing adhesive tape is pressure sensitive, such that sealing can be realized with finger pressure, wherein the pressure sensitivity is provided by polyisobutylene; the sealing adhesive tape has good adhesiveness on various sealing films and molds. A vacuum bag prepared with the sealing adhesive tape can provide pressure close to 1atm. With the sealing adhesive tape, long-time sealing can be realized under room temperature to 220 DEG C, and leakage is prevented. The sealing adhesive tape is convenient to use.

Structural pressure-sensitive adhesive, structural pressure-sensitive adhesive tape and preparation method of structural pressure-sensitive adhesive and structural pressure-sensitive adhesive tape

The invention discloses a structural pressure-sensitive adhesive, a structural pressure-sensitive adhesive tape and a preparation method of the structural pressure-sensitive adhesive and the structural pressure-sensitive adhesive tape. The structural pressure-sensitive adhesive comprises a constituent A and a constituent B. The constituent A is obtained by polymerizing acrylic acid-2-ethylhexyl ester, butyl acrylate, vinylacetate, methyl methacrylate, acrylic acid, glycerol ester of hydrogenated rosin, dibenzoyl peroxide, ethyl acetate and epoxy resin in a reactor. The constituent A is coatedon a base material to manufacture a pressure-sensitive adhesive tape; the constituent B, which is polyfunctional organic amine epoxy hardener 2,4,6-tri(dimethylamino methyl)phenol, is painted on the surface of a pasted object; the pressure-sensitive adhesive tape is pasted on the surface of the pasted object to form the structural pressure-sensitive adhesive tape. The structural pressure-sensitive adhesive tape disclosed by the invention has pressure sensitivity at the beginning of use, and has the performances of structural adhesives at the later stage of use; the proportion of the tackinessagent A and the curing agent B is unnecessary to be determined, so the adhesive tape is convenient to use; in addition, the bonding strength is large, thus the structural pressure-sensitive adhesive tap is very suitable for field application.

Constant-pressure exhaust braking method and low-cost constant-pressure exhaust braking butterfly valve

The invention discloses a constant-pressure exhaust braking method. The method comprises the steps of arranging a valve, arranging a rotary shaft to penetrate through the valve, fixing a valve sheet on the rotary shaft, arranging a gas inlet on the valve sheet, and fixing a constant-pressure exhaust component at the gas inlet; fixing the valve on a mounting plate, fixing the tail end of a cylinder on the mounting plate, fixing a swing arm at the top end of the rotary shaft, and hinging the tail end of an output shaft of the cylinder with the tail end of the swing arm; and fixing the valve at an exhaust port of a motor. When the motor is required to be braked, the rotary shaft is driven by the cylinder, and an exhaust pipe is sealed by the valve sheet, so that back pressure is produced by the motor exhaust, the constant-pressure exhaust component is opened due to gas pressure when the back pressure reaches a set constant-pressure value, and when the back pressure is lower than the set constant-pressure value, the constant-pressure exhaust component is closed, the constant-pressure exhaust component is controlled by the back pressure to be closed and opened repeatedly, and automatic constant-pressure exhaust is achieved. The invention further discloses a low-cost constant-pressure exhaust braking butterfly valve.
